TPG-managed Rise Fund leads Cellulant deal
Cellulant, a digital payments provider, has raised a growth round from a group of investors led by the TPG Growth-managed Rise Fund.

Cellulant raises capital from an investor consortium led by TPG Growth's The Rise Fund.

Consonance Kuramo takes equity in Century
Consonance Kuramo Special Opportunities Fund is taking an equity stake in real estate platform Century Development.
Private Equity
Moringa backs Togolese juice processor
The Moringa Fund announced its sixth investment last week, backing a Togolese company developing a juice processing factory.

Sub-Saharan private investment slowed in 2015 and 2016
A brief analysis from Brookings on the IMF's latest report that finds private investment growth slowed or turned negative in a majority of sub-Saharan countries in 2015-2016.
Perspectives
Private investment in Africa is "about to explode"
In spite of a pull back in private investment in 2015 and 2016, TLG Capital's Zhi Yong Heng discusses his view that its set to explode in sub-Saharan Africa.
Perspectives
Reasons to be bullish on FinTech in Africa
An op-ed piece for CNBC Africa by investor and entrepreneur Issam Chleuh on why FinTech is the next big thing for financial services in Francophone Africa.

Bayakha taps Kodisang to head investment committee
Bayakha Investment Partners has appointed Ben Kodisang as Chair of the South African infrastructure fund manager's investment committee.
People
Actis appoints new head of EMEA IR
Actis has appointed Sovereign Capital's former head of investor relations to head up fundraising and investor relations across Europe, the Middle East and Africa..
People
Orrick boosts Abidjan team with Partner hire
International law firm Orrick has boosted the number of lawyers in its affiliate office in Abidjan.
